  6. How to Clear Safari's Browsing History and Cookies on macOS

    If you simply want to clear part of your history, you can click "Show History" ("Command + Y"). Click on the site or use the "Command" key to select several sites, then press the "Delete" key. You can also click "Clear History" in the upper right corner to remove everything all at once. You can also right-click a history entry to delete it.

  8. How to Wipe Your Browsing History Automatically in Safari on Mac

    Launch Safari on your Mac from the Launchpad or by looking it up on Spotlight . Next, click "Safari" from the left corner of the menu bar and select "Preferences." Alternatively, you can press Cmd+comma on your keyboard to head directly into this menu. Under the "General" tab, locate the "Remove History Items" option.

  9. How to Delete Specific Website History From Safari on ...

    Open Safari and tap on the "Bookmarks" icon at the bottom of the screen (it looks like an open book). A pop-up will appear with three tabs for your Bookmarks, Reading List, and History. Tap on the clock icon to see your history. You can now swipe left on any entry in your history and tap "Delete" to remove it for good.

  17. Clearing Safari website data does not del…

    This doesn't clear them: Settings>Safari>Clear History and Website Data. Neither does this: Settings>Safari>Advanced>Website Data>Remove All Website Data. This does work: Individually swiping left on the persisting data and selecting "delete". This, IMO, is an unusual behavior since the first method SHOULD do this job.

  18. Clear Private Data, Caches and Cookies on Mac

    To remove your browsing history, cookies, caches, and other website data from Safari on your Mac and across any synchronized devices: Select Safari > Clear History from the menu bar at the top of the Safari screen. Select the Clear dropdown arrow and choose either the last hour, today, today and yesterday, or all history .
